The chokepoint is not a single monopoly but an accumulation: as Europe's largest applied-research organization (budget ~EUR 3.6 billion, over 30,000 staff, 74 institutes, 2024), Fraunhofer feeds entire industry sectors and holds structuring underlying patents, including the MP3/AAC audio codecs (Fraunhofer IIS) that generated hundreds of millions of euros in licensing. Redundancy is real for research taken individually, but the depth of the portfolio and its German industrial roots make it hard to replicate. Fragility is mainly budgetary and political, not a rupture risk (2024).
